Student Hiring Information for GW Departments


The Career Center “hires,” i.e., creates employment records in Banner, for student wage account employees (account 51229) and Federal Work Study employees (account 51225).  We also administer the following aspects of the GW Federal Work Study (FWS) Program:

*      Annual distribution and collection of Federal Work Study Participation Agreements and Job Posting forms

*      Posting of all available FWS jobs online through our GWork job listing service

*      Completion of I-9 Employment Eligibility Verification forms and distribution of I-9 receipts to students

*      Collection of tax forms and direct deposit forms

*      Production of resource materials and consultations for students and employers participating in the FWS program

*      Orientation and training sessions for employers, including “Managing Student Employees” and “Hiring Student Employees” offered several times each year in conjunction with GW’s Employee Training and Development

*      Organization and sponsorship of the annual Federal Work Study Job Fair (this year on Thursday, September 6, 2007, from 1:00–4:00 pm in the Marvin Center Grand Ballroom. Click here for more information.

The monetary aspects of the Federal Work Study program – who gets a FWS award, the amount of the FWS award, any changes to the FWS award – are handled solely by GW’s Office of Student Financial Assistance (OSFA).  The GW Career Center does not have access to student financial aid data – it is protected by the 1974 federal privacy law called “FERPA,” or Family Education Rights Privacy Act.  If your student employee has questions about any aspect of his or her financial aid package, including his or her Federal Work Study award, please refer them to GW’s OSFA. THE ONLINE “STUDENT HIRE APPLICATION” IS HERE!


The Career Center and ISS are pleased to announce the release of an automated workflow application supporting student employment processes at GW. This application includes the process for online initiation and approval of temporary and Federal Work Study student hires. It is the result of the collaboration between Information Systems and Services and the Career Center's Student Employment unit with stakeholders from numerous departments across the University. 

The new Student Hire process, which is a web-based form accessed through the myGW portal, is now available.

The new electronic process will:

*      Provide an electronic alternative to the current paper hire form, which will continue to be available for use as well; 

*      Track the completion of the required I-9 form;

*      For Federal Work Study students, provide an electronic alternative to the current printed Employment Authorization Form (EAF) with a self-service form to be printed by the student for use in verifying and monitoring the current status of Federal Work Study funding.

SPONSORED PROJECTS
Please note that if you are attempting to hire a student funded partially or in full by a sponsored project, please continue using the current paper-based student hiring process. The new electronic process is still being adapted for sponsored projects. An announcement regarding the availability date for applying the new electronic process for student hiring on sponsored projects will be forthcoming shortly.
